ReadDefINFOSTAT Class Reference
[Default USRs]

Read INFOSTAT: Read miscellaneous device state informations. More...

#include <default-usrs-vme.hh>

List of all members.

Public Member Functions

 ReadDefINFOSTAT (VmeDevice *dev)
virtual
DeviceAccess::AccDevRetStatus 
read (SLong vrtAcc, const DeviceAccess::AccData &para, DeviceAccess::AccData &data, DeviceAccess::AccStamp &stamp, DeviceAccess::AccEFICD &eficd)

Detailed Description

Read INFOSTAT: Read miscellaneous device state informations.

Property:

Name:

INFOSTAT

Mode:

Read

Therapy lock:

None

Category:

Master

Access constraint:

Free


Member Function Documentation

virtual DeviceAccess::AccDevRetStatus read ( SLong  vrtAcc,
const DeviceAccess::AccData &  para,
DeviceAccess::AccData &  data,
DeviceAccess::AccStamp &  stamp,
DeviceAccess::AccEFICD &  eficd 
) [virtual]
Parameters:
vrtAcc Not used
para Not used
data 

Data

Type

Description

0

ULong

Device master status

1

ULong

Active state pattern, leftmost bit refers to vrtAcc 0

2

ULong

Severest master error

3..18

ULong

Severest slave errors for all VrtAccs, element 3 refers to VrtAcc 0, element 18 refers to VrtAcc 15

19

ULong

EC mode, default mode in upper 16-bit word, actual mode in lower 16-bit word. Values may be
0 = not set
1 = preset command
2 = command
3 = preset event
4 = event

20

ULong

EC performance mode, default mode in upper 16-bit word, actual mode in lower 16-bit word. Values may be 0 = not set
1 = display
2 = preset turbo
3 = turbo

21

ULong

Hardware warning mask

22

ULong

PZ ID

23..24

ULong

reserved

stamp Timestamp contains the actual time, eventstamp is zero.
eficd Not used

The documentation for this class was generated from the following file:

Generated on 24 Jan 2018 for DTI-USRs by  doxygen 1.6.1